How is Kaiser Permanente different from other HMOs?
Kaiser Permanente, unlike many other HMOs, is a nonprofit organization. Kaiser Permanente protects physician decision making from the oversight and approval of insurance administrators. We are committed to the needs of our members and our social obligation to provide benefit for the communities in which we operate, rather than by the needs of shareholders. Kaiser Permanente has been touted nationally as a leader in the electronic medical records movement and as a potential model for healthcare nationally.
